Conn. Agencies Regs. § 22-86-1
Control areas comprising the below named towns, within which all ribes, both wild and cultivated, growing within nine hundred feet of a white pine stand one acre or more in extent, may be destroyed by a duly accredited representative of the Connecticut Agricultural Experiment Station, are hereby designated:
